1.7 lbs. Wood-Craft Camp Carver, 22 in. Straight Handle, with a high quality Leather Mask: The Council Tool Co.&';s WOOD-CRAFT Camp Carver is designed to be a multi-use bushcraft/camping axe, and a carving axe for fine woodworking. The design has its heritage in the larger riggers axes of North America, the bearded axes of Northern Europe. It&';s a carver (bushcraft axe) that you don&';t have to worry about bringing into the woods with you, or letting it get dirty while doing camp-chores. With a swept toe, flat-grind, large bit length, bearded blade, and a radius under the hammer poll for the web of the user&';s hand, it was made to choke up, shave, and do detailed work. The poll is hardened and can be used like a hammer. It helps with balance of the head overall, and gives leverage when choking up. It has a 90 deg. spine for scraping tinder and for using a ferro-rod to start fires in a pinch, or just for fun. The handle is straight for one or two handed use and can be cut to a custom size with a large hatchet eye to provide strength/durability, and a comfortable grip when choking up.
